摘要
目的:观察丹参酮IIA磺酸钠(STS)对血管紧张素II(Ang II)诱导的心肌肥大及p-ERK表达的影响。方法:培养新生大鼠心肌细胞,考马斯亮蓝法测定心肌细胞蛋白含量、[3H]-亮氨酸掺入法测定蛋白合成速率作为心肌肥大指标;用West-ern-blot测定p-ERK表达。结果:STS能显著降低Ang II诱导的心肌细胞总蛋白含量、蛋白合成速率上升,同时对p-ERK表达具有剂量、时间依赖性抑制作用。结论:STS可以抑制Ang II诱导的心肌肥大,机制与抑制p-ERK表达有关。
OBJECTIVE To observe effects of sodium tanshinone IIA sulfonate (STS) on angiotension II( Ang II)-induced cardiomyocyte hypertrophy and the expression of phosphorylated extracellular signal-regulated kinase (p-ERK). IVIETHODS In the primary culture of neonatal rat cardiomyocytes, as indexes of cardiomyocyte hypertrophy, the total protein was determined by Coomassie brilliant blue and protein synthesis rate was measured by [^3 H]-Leucine incorporation. The expression of p-ERK was assessed using Western blot. RESULTS STS can decrease Ang II-induced elevations of the total protein and protein synthesis rate; and inhibit the expression of p-ERK in a dose- and time-dependent manner. ClDNCLUSION The anti-hypertrophic effects of STS on cardiomyocyte hypertrophy induced by Ang II are associated with inhibition of ERK signaling pathway.
